Subject: [PATCH 2/2] kvm: do not store wqh in irqfd
Date: Wed, 13 Jan 2010 19:12:39 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20100113171239.GC19798@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<cover.1263402727.git.mst@redhat.com>

wqh is unused, so we do not need to store it in irqfd anymore

Signed-off-by: Michael S. Tsirkin <mst@redhat.com>
---
 virt/kvm/eventfd.c |    3 ---
 1 files changed, 0 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/virt/kvm/eventfd.c b/virt/kvm/eventfd.c
index a9d3fc6..ee17ab4 100644
--- a/virt/kvm/eventfd.c
+++ b/virt/kvm/eventfd.c
@@ -47,7 +47,6 @@ struct _irqfd {
 	int                       gsi;
 	struct list_head          list;
 	poll_table                pt;
-	wait_queue_head_t        *wqh;
 	wait_queue_t              wait;
 	struct work_struct        inject;
 	struct work_struct        shutdown;
@@ -159,8 +158,6 @@ irqfd_ptable_queue_proc(struct file *file, wait_queue_head_t *wqh,
 			poll_table *pt)
 {
 	struct _irqfd *irqfd = container_of(pt, struct _irqfd, pt);
-
-	irqfd->wqh = wqh;
 	add_wait_queue(wqh, &irqfd->wait);
 }
